How much do Tax Examiners and Collectors, and Revenue Agents make in Maine?
The median Tax Examiners and Collectors, and Revenue Agents in Maine earns $63,290 per year (BLS May 2025), about $30.43 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$63,290 gross in Maine keeps $49,943 after federal income tax ($5,415), FICA ($4,842) and state income tax ($3,090) — $4,162 per month, a 78.9% keep-rate.
How does Maine compare to the national median for Tax Examiners and Collectors, and Revenue Agents?
The Maine median is $920 above the national median of $62,370.
Which state pays Tax Examiners and Collectors, and Revenue Agents the most?
New Jersey has the highest median gross for Tax Examiners and Collectors, and Revenue Agents at $96,420 — but compare take-home, not gross: state taxes change the order.
